Abu Dhabi, Sept. 11 -- Bangladesh cruised to a seven-wicket win over Hong Kong in the third Group B match of the Asia Cup 2025 at the Sheikh Zayed Stadium here tonight, riding on captain Litton Das' sparkling 59 and Towhid Hridoy's composed unbeaten 35.
Chasing 144, Bangladesh finished at 144 for three in 17.4 overs. Litton was bowled by Ateeq Iqbal at 17.1 overs, just two runs short of the target, after striking six fours and a six off 39 balls. Earlier, he reached his fifty with a pull for two off Yasim Murtaza and launched a slog-sweep for six over mid-wicket. He also unfurled a series of elegant boundaries - a reverse sweep off Kinchit Shah, a clever scoop and pull off Ayush Shukla, and a crisp drive against Ehsan Khan.
